Around 70% of the US’s nuclear weapons are on these submarines and stealth bombers like the B-2 Spirit. The rest are in the continental US, in nuclear missile silos that release Intercontinental Ballistic Missiles (ICBM) like the Minuteman III. LGM-30 Minuteman III. Five hundred Minuteman III missiles are deployed at four bases in the north- central United States: Minot AFB and Grand Forks AFB, North Dakota, Malmstrom AFB, Montana, and F. E. Warren AFB, Wyoming. Operational since 1968, the model "G" differs from the "F" in the third stage and reentry system.

Titan ICBM During the summer of 1954, the Air Force acknowledged the obvious limitations of the Atlas ICBM and began rapid studies on a new weapon system to serve as a back up in case the Atlas failed.
